GST Basics: What Is It?
Goods and Services Tax (GST) is a value-added tax on most goods and services sold for domestic consumption. The concept is straightforward, but calculating it manually leads to errors when switching between inclusive and exclusive prices. A reliable GST calculator keeps your figures correct from day one.
Output Tax and Input Tax for Business
As a business owner you act as a tax collector: you charge GST on sales (Output Tax) and claim back GST on business expenses (Input Tax). The difference is what you pay to or receive from the tax office. Using a calculator ensures these numbers are right and prevents headaches at tax time.
Common GST Calculation Mistakes
The most common error is applying the rate to a total price—e.g. for a $115 total at 15%, the GST is $15, not $17.25. Always use a calculator with 'Inclusive' mode. Manual rounding of cents also causes drift over many transactions; our tool follows standard accounting rounding rules.
Compliance and Record-Keeping
Many regions require GST registration only after turnover exceeds a limit (e.g. NZ $60,000). Different countries have different rules for what is exempt or zero-rated—always check your local guide. Keep valid tax invoices for every GST claim; the calculator gives the number, but you need the paper trail.
Global GST & VAT Rates 2026
| Country | Standard Rate | Tax Type |
|---|---|---|
| New Zealand | 15% | GST |
| Australia | 10% | GST |
| United Kingdom | 20% | VAT |
| Singapore | 9% | GST |
| India (Avg) | 18% | GST |
| Malaysia | 0% | GST |
